    Baidu Unveils “Ernie Bot” to Rival Open AI’s “ChatGPT”

    1
    By Smart Megwai on March 22, 2023 Artificial Intelligence, Technology

    Chinese tech giant Baidu has launched its own chatbot, Ernie Bot, which is set to rival OpenAI’s ChatGPT. Ernie Bot is powered by Baidu’s deep learning AI model, ERNIE (Enhanced Representation through Knowledge Integration), and is capable of performing a range of tasks such as solving mathematical equations and generating images and videos in response to text prompts.

    While Ernie Bot has been met with excitement, it has also faced criticism from investors and analysts. During a prerecorded demonstration of the bot’s capabilities, it fell short of expectations, leading to a 6.4% fall in Baidu’s Hong Kong shares and a drop in the company’s market valuation by over $3 billion.

    However, despite this initial setback, over 650 Chinese companies have already signed up to become part of Ernie Bot’s ecosystem, which will be integrated with Baidu’s other products. Baidu’s CEO also announced plans to integrate the chatbot into its search services, cloud services, smart car operating system, and smart speaker from March.

    Baidu’s launch of Ernie Bot is a significant move in the company’s efforts to lead China’s development of a rival to OpenAI’s ChatGPT. Other Chinese tech companies, including ByteDance and Tencent, have also announced plans to launch their own chatbots, as the global rush to develop AI-driven conversational agents continues.

    Ernie Bot’s success will depend on its ability to provide natural and accurate responses to user queries and tasks. Baidu claims that its chatbot can understand and generate human-like responses, and the company has been investing heavily in AI research and development to make this a reality.

    The launch of Ernie Bot also signals a shift in Baidu’s revenue streams. While most of the company’s revenue comes from online marketing services, it has been investing in other areas such as autonomous driving technology and AI research.
